Iowa’s Water Crisis Could Help Tip the Scales for Control of US House

  • InsideClimate News faviconInsideClimate News

    By By Anika Jane BeamerFeb 17, 2026, 4:49 pm238 ptsTop
    photo of Iowa’s Water Crisis Could Help Tip the Scales for Control of US House imageA new poll finds that 85 percent of Iowans in “toss-up” congressional districts would be more likely to vote for a candidate who prioritizes clean water and cuts to industrial agriculture pollution. By Anika Jane Beamer Two key congressional races will be decided by Iowa voters who say clean water is a top…
